About

This native iOS app provides secure and efficient file management for WebDAV servers. It allows users to connect via HTTP or HTTPS, manage multiple servers, and perform various file operations like sharing, downloading, and uploading. The app also offers rich media previews for common file types.

Secure WebDAV server connection (HTTP/HTTPS)
Basic and digest authentication
Manage multiple WebDAV servers
File sharing, downloading, and uploading
Remote directory browsing and file deletion
Rich media file previews

What's New in WebDAV Manager

2.0

June 8, 2025

- New "expert mode" when adding new server URL: type the URL yourself instead of filling the fields. - Image previews in the list. - Adapt file icons to the file type. - Fixed a minor issue that incorrectly displayed an error message in the files list view. - Fixed other bugs.

FAQ

What is WebDAV Manager?

WebDAV Manager is a native iOS application designed for managing files on WebDAV servers. It allows users to connect, browse, upload, download, and share files securely.

Does WebDAV Manager support multiple servers?

Yes, WebDAV Manager supports managing multiple WebDAV servers simultaneously from a single, intuitive interface, allowing for efficient organization of your remote file storage.

What types of files can be previewed in WebDAV Manager?

WebDAV Manager offers rich media previews for common file types including text files, PDFs, images, and videos, enabling quick content verification without needing to download.
